PRIMARY PURPOSE(S)
The primary purpose of the Deputy Director of IR Research is to facilitate, promote, and expand translational and clinical research within the Division. In particular, the Division has pioneered a data-driven approach to Interventional Radiology with structured reporting systems for clinical evaluation of patients as well as procedural dictations, and we seek an individual to maintain current systems and expand these efforts in order to answer clinical research questions.
